M&T Bank CorporationMTB-- (MTB) has recently announced its next quarterly cash dividend, set at $1.500 per share, which will be distributed on Sep 30, 2025. The ex-dividend date for this payment is Sep 2, 2025, meaning investors must own shares by that date to be eligible for the dividend. The dividend was declared on Aug 19, 2025, and marks a significant increase from the average of the last 10 dividend payments, which stood at approximately $0.784 per share. This latest payout continues the company’s tradition of cash dividends, aligning with the prior dividend issued on Jun 30, 2025, at $1.350 per share. Investors should note that Sep 2, 2025, is the final day to purchase MTBMTB-- shares and receive the upcoming dividend; any purchase after this date will not qualify for the distribution. Another noteworthy development is the appointment of Tracy Woodrow as Regional President for Western New York. Woodrow, who previously served as Chief Administrative Officer, brings a strong focus on community and culture to her new role. Her leadership is anticipated to bolster local operations and enhance customer relationships in the region.
